I have RA3 through Steam, did the hook up with cnc online as described in the documentation.
 
I wanted to play online: enter my email, server password, click login, and in a few seconds get this "Could not connect to the backend server" error.
I have never tried playing online before.
 
Operating system: Windows 10
 
CNCOnline_Log.txt:
 
----- C&C:Online Launcher Start -----
Game: Red Alert 3
Red Alert 3 Install Path: C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am\steamapps\common\Command and Conquer Red Alert 3\
Started game with: "RA3.exe "
Caught CREATE_PROCESS_DEBUG_EVENT from Red Alert 3. Detaching...
Found game.dat process. PID 3572
*** Starting CA public key patching routine ***
CA public key is expected value.
Successfully patched CA public key.
*** Starting hostname hooking routine ***
Injecting DLL into game.dat process...
Result of injection: Code -1073741582
 
 
Other notes: I used to have an older version of RA3 on my computer, it wasn't from Steam. Could it cause some problems? I removed the Red Alert 3 folder from the AppData/Roaming folder to make sure it won't use some old settings.

Please could you open Windows PowerShell (type PowerShell at the start menu) and in the window type and enter

Test-NetConnection peerchat.server.cnc-online.net -port 6667

Then post the output in here.
